Nokia provides its WAP Gateway to Guangdong MCC in China

Tuesday 9 March 2004 09:36 CET | News

Nokia and Guangdong Mobile Communications Corporation (MCC) have agreed on the supply of Nokias WAP Gateway solution to provide WAPservice to the majority of Chinas Guangdong province. The system provided by Nokia is one of the largest implementations of the Nokia WAP Gateway to date, able to handle a massive number of simultaneous WAP sessions. The Nokia WAP Gateway provides reliable and scalable access to convenient WAP browsing services such as news access and online tickets purchasing. It also supports other advanced solutions for accessing rich content services, including MMS and content download. The system for Guangdong MCC has been implemented and is already operational. Nokia has also provided an extensive range of services including implementation, systems integration and customized load pressure testing for fast service ramp up. In addition, for optimal service availability, Nokia will provide care services including software maintenance, help desk, emergency support, health check services, on-site support, as well as training services.
